TITLE:
Microwave Application and Anhydrous Cu(OAc)2 Mediated O-Arylation of Aliphatic Amino Alcohols
AUTHORS:
Mohammad Al-Masum, Linda Quinones, Laurance T. Cain
KEYWORDS:
Hydroxylamine, Amino Ether, O-Arylation, O-Styrylation, Microwave
JOURNAL NAME:
International Journal of Organic Chemistry,
Vol.6 No.2,
May
27,
2016
ABSTRACT: Anhydrous Cu(OAc)2 mediated efficient protocol has been developed in the area of C-O coupling from potassium aryltrifluoroborates and aliphatic amino alcohols such as β-hydroxy, γ-hydroxy, and δ-hydroxy amines. The scope of this transformation focuses on direct O-arylation and O-styrylation. The reaction vial loaded with reactants under argon atmosphere is microwaved at 140°C for 30 min to furnish the corresponding cross-coupling product, amino ethers, in good yields.
